Located in the heart of Norway, Hegra offers a wide range of adventure sports that cater to all levels, from beginners to experienced thrill-seekers. Nestled among picturesque fjords and mountains, Hegra is an ideal destination for nature lovers and those looking for an adrenaline rush.
Popular Activities:
Rock Climbing
- Difficulty Level: Easy to challenging routes available
- Best Time: June to September (dry season)
- Equipment Needed: Essential climbing gear, including harnesses, ropes, and carabiners
Kayaking
- Experience Required: Basic kayaking skills recommended
- Duration: Half-day to full-day trips available
- Tips: Wear warm clothing and waterproof gear for comfort
Hiking
- Difficulty Level: Easy to moderate trails suitable for all ages
- Best Time: June to September (good weather)
- Safety First: Always carry a map, compass, and sufficient food and water
Important Safety Information:
- Always check the weather forecast before engaging in any outdoor activity.
- Wear proper protective gear and follow safety guidelines provided by local guides or instructors.
- Respect the environment and local regulations to preserve Hegra’s natural beauty.
